FOOD NETWORK IS HITTING THE ROAD TO FIND ITS NEWEST STAR

Network Announces Fourth Season of “The Next Food Network Star”

Conducting Open-Call Auditions in New York, Los Angeles, Las Vegas, Seattle and Minneapolis



For Immediate Release – Food Network has greenlit a fourth season of its hugely successful reality series The Next Food Network Star and for the first time will be will be holding open-call auditions in order to find aspiring TV chefs, it was announced today by Bob Tuschman, Senior Vice President, Programming for Food Network. The recently completed third season of Star was the highest-rated cable food series ever and Food Network is searching for outstanding chefs and home cooks to join the ranks of past winners like Guy Fieri and the newly crowned Amy Finley to compete for the opportunity to win his or her own Food Network series.



"Season three of The Next Food Network Star performed beyond our wildest expectations and we are thrilled to extend this exciting franchise into a fourth season," says Tuschman. “As always, we are looking for people who have strong culinary knowledge and vibrant personalities who can pass along their passion for cooking to our viewers.”



The network is currently conducting a nation-wide talent search and encourages both professional and amateur chefs to apply. Applicants have until Friday, October 12, 2007 to send in a three minute audition tape explaining why he/she should be Food Network’s newest star. Applications and contest rules can be downloaded from www.FoodNetwork.com starting Tuesday, September 5. In addition, contestant hopefuls can also apply in person at one of five open-call auditions that will be held around the country. Applicants should bring an application, photograph and resume and/or bio to the auditions, which will allow them to meet with network casting directors. Locations will include:
